Сan I mix clean signal of my bass with IRcab in this pedal? I think its most important features in all cabsim pedals for bass
@kevinhide6560
@kevinhide6560 3 жыл бұрын
The cab sim is on the distortion side of the circuit. If you turn distortion off, but blend fully wet, you'll have 100% clean/compressed IR signal, which can then blend back with the non-IR to taste.
